Establishes early childhood mental health consultation grants and modifies rights for home and community-based services.
The bill establishes an early childhood mental health consultation grant program to support mental health care for children aged five and under. It modifies protection-related rights for individuals in home and community-based services, ensuring they have access to essential services and personal freedoms. The bill also modifies day treatment program requirements, ensuring they meet specific staffing and facility standards. It includes provisions for reporting and outcome measurement to evaluate the effectiveness of the services provided.
